JMP扩展功能:实时数据捕获、DLL与套接字应用
在数据分析和处理领域,JMP软件提供了丰富的扩展功能,能够满足不同场景下的数据处理和分析需求。本文将重点介绍JMP的实时数据捕获、动态链接库(DLL)以及套接字使用等方面的内容。
1. 实时数据捕获
实时数据捕获是指通过Datafeed对象从外部数据源(如实验室测量设备)连续读取数据的过程。Datafeed对象会创建一个并发线程和输入队列,用于实时接收和处理数据。
1.1 创建Datafeed对象
使用 Open DataFeed 命令创建Datafeed对象,可指定连接的详细信息。示例代码如下:
feed = Open DataFeed(
Connect(
Port( "com1:" ),
Baud( 9600 ),
DataBits( 7 )
),
Set Script( Print( feed << getLine ) )
);
在上述代码中, Connect 参数用于设置连接端口的详细信息, Set Script 参数用于指定处理接收到的数据的脚本。
创建Datafeed对象时,可选择将对象引用存储在全局变量中,方便后续操作。例如:
feed2 = Data Feed[2];
超级会员免费看
订阅专栏 解锁全文

1545

被折叠的 条评论
为什么被折叠?



